gas stream containing a valuable hydrocarbon (Molecular weight=44) is to be scrubbed with
a non-volatile oil (Molecular weight=300) in a tower packed with 1-inch Raschig rings. The
entering gas contains 20 mol% hydrocarbon and 95% of this hydrocarbon is to be recovered.
The inert gas molecular weight is 29. The gas stream enters the column at 5000 kg/m2
.hr and
hydrocarbon free oil enters the top of the column at 10000 kg/m2
.hr.
(i) Calculate the exit gas and exit liquid mole fractions. (ii) With a simple sketch,
precisely show various streams and their corresponding values. (iii) Develop a
mathematical expression of the operating line (on inert basis).(iv) If the equilibrium
data is given, can the Colburns analytical method be used to find NTU or NOG for the
aforementioned numerical? Justify.
